Did you catch the lighted sign behind Derrick today in Music & The Spoken Word? The “Broadcasting, Quiet Please” sign is a historic piece mounted below the pipes and was recently refurbished and brought back to life after not being used for about forty years.

During their 1992–93 tour to Jerusalem, the Choir recorded Music & the Spoken Word and sang Christ-centered hymns at sacred sites including Shepherds’ Field, the Sea of Galilee, and the Garden Tomb. Read this article from Church News— thechurchnews.com/2018/12/9/2322…
